Why we clone disk?

Hard drive cloning involves duplicating all the data from one disk onto another, resulting in an exact replica of the original drive. This means that the cloned hard drive, complete with the operating system and installed applications, will function just like the initial disk. This eliminates the necessity of reinstalling the OS and other software applications on the cloned drive.

Via cloning, you may simply replace your existing little old hard drive with a larger one to get more space, or you can upgrade to SSD to gain better performance. Additionally, if your disk is failing, you can replace it quickly in advance.

Does Windows 10 have a built-in clone tool?

It's a shame that Windows 10 doesn't have a disk-copying tool. So, if you want to clone Windows 10 to SSD, you'll need third-party software. This type of program works with a variety of disk types and brands, allowing you to clone HDD to M.2 SSD, small SSD to large SSD, SATS to M.2 SSD, and so on.

The "Clone Disk" function allows you to produce a perfect replica of the target disk, including the operating system, all data, and installed programs. As a result, disk cloning is commonly used as a backup strategy to preserve data from inadvertent data loss due to disaster or while replacing a hard drive owing to physical or technical problems.

Clone methods

The "Migrate OS" function refers to a copy of the original operating system. In this approach, the tool will only replicate the system partition and system-related partition(s), such as the EFI system partition and the recovery partition.

All information necessary for the system to run in the destination location, including any files saved on system partitions, relevant programs, drivers, updates, and customizable settings, will be transferred.
